Intro to Robot Vacuums and Mops

Robot vacuums and mops are autonomous gadgets developed to clean floorings without human intervention. They use a combination of sensing units, mapping technology, and artificial intelligence algorithms to navigate and clean efficiently. These devices are particularly helpful for families that require frequent cleaning, such as those with family pets or children, and for individuals who have actually limited time or mobility.

How Robot Vacuums and Mops Work

Navigation and Mapping

  • Sensing units: These gadgets utilize a range of sensing units, including infrared, ultrasonic, and visual, to discover barriers and browse the environment.
  • Mapping Technology: Some models create a map of the home, which they utilize to enhance cleaning paths and avoid cleaning the same location several times.

Cleaning Mechanisms

  • Vacuums: They use suction to pick up dirt, dust, and debris from carpets and hard floorings.
  • Mops: They give water and cleaning option, then scrub and dry the floor utilizing microfiber pads or rotating brushes.

Connectivity and Control

  • Smart Home Integration: Many robot vacuums and mops can be integrated with smart home systems, permitting voice control and scheduling.
  • App Control: Users can manage and monitor their gadgets via smartphone apps, which frequently provide real-time updates and cleaning history.

Common FAQs

Are robot vacuums and mops reliable?

  • Yes, they are extremely effective for preserving a clean home. While they may not replace deep cleaning, they are excellent for regular upkeep and can manage most everyday dirt and particles.

Do they work well in homes with family pets?

  • Absolutely. Numerous models are specifically created to deal with pet hair and dander, making them perfect for households with family pets.

How often should I clean up the robot?

  • Regular upkeep is vital. Empty the dustbin after each use, tidy the brushes weekly, and replace filters according to the maker's guidelines.

Can they browse stairs?

  • The majority of robot vacuums and mops are developed to avoid stairs to avoid falls. Nevertheless, some designs have stair-climbing abilities for multi-level homes.

Are they pricey?

  • Rates vary, but there are affordable options readily available. High-end models with advanced features can be more costly, but the convenience and time savings they use might justify the cost.

Can they clean up under furnishings?

  • Yes, the majority of designs are developed to fit under furniture and tidy hard-to-reach locations.

Upkeep and Troubleshooting

Routine Cleaning

  • Empty the Dustbin: Do this after each use to avoid overflow.
  • Clean Brushes and Filters: Remove hair and particles from brushes weekly and change filters as needed.

Software application Updates

  • Stay Updated: Regularly upgrade the device's software to guarantee optimal performance and security.

Obstacle Management

  • Clear Pathways: Keep the cleaning area without small objects and challenges.
  • Adjust Settings: Use virtual limits to prevent the device from getting in specific locations.

Typical Issues and Solutions

  • Stuck on Carpet: Adjust the height settings or utilize a ramp to help the device navigate.
  • Low Battery: Ensure the device has a trusted auto-return feature to return to the charging dock when required.
  • Error Messages: Refer to the user manual for troubleshooting ideas or contact client support.
